Do you put long curtains on short windows?

Do you put long curtains on short windows?

Hanging long drapes on a short window is one of the easiest ways to increase the importance of the window and bring it into proportion to the room. The correct design and length will minimize poor window style and hint that the window is much grander than it actually is.

Do curtains look better short or long?

How Long Should Curtains Be? Floor-length is the way to go, unless there’s a radiator or a deep sill in the way. You’ll get the most current look if the fabric makes contact with the floor (or sill or radiator). Too-short curtains can seem nerdy and off, like high-waters.

How low should curtains hang below window sill?

A rule of thumb (from Architectural Digest) is that curtains should be hung between four to six inches above the window frame, so install your curtain rod accordingly. When you hang the curtain rod high, it will make the window appear taller.

What is the correct length for window curtains?

Standard curtains come in three lengths—84 inches, 96 inches, or 108 inches. “Generally, you want to stay away from the 84 inch standard curtains unless you have very low ceilings. They don’t look right in most scenarios and end up being an awkward length,” says Curtis.

How far should curtain rods extend from window?

As a general rule, drapes will be open during the day, so make sure the curtain rod extends at least four inches on each side of the window’s inside frame. To create the illusion of a wider window, extend the rod up to 10 inches beyond the window’s frame.

Is it OK to have short curtains?

Short Curtains Visually speaking, high-water style is not the most appealing way to hang curtains. The shorter length can appear dated. Also, it can cut the visual height of your room in half. From a purely practical standpoint, however, short curtains are sometimes the best option.

Can you put one curtain on a window?

Can you use one curtain panel on a window? The answer is yes! Most often you see two panels per window, but if your window is small, you can easily get away with one panel. If you have two large windows or a super-wide door, then two separate panels complete the look better.

What’s wrong with short curtains?

Too-short curtains Short curtains will let in daylight when you’re trying to blackout the room, and will allow evening draughts from the vents into the room. If the room still feels uncomfortably draughty after you’ve lengthened those curtains, you should inspect your vents and windows for leaks.
